Understanding Climate Impact on Floor Drains
Climate plays a pivotal role in determining the type of **floor drain** you should install. Regions with heavy rainfall or flooding require drains that can handle a high volume of water flow. Conversely, areas with arid climates may prioritize different characteristics, such as durability against extreme heat. Here are some specific climate considerations.
Wet and Humid Climates
In places where rainfall is consistent, drainage systems must effectively manage water accumulation. **Floor drains** in these areas should have larger grates to prevent clogging from debris and ensure speedy drainage. Additionally, materials resistant to corrosion, such as stainless steel or PVC, are preferred due to their longevity in wet conditions.
Cold and Snowy Climates
For regions that experience snow, the **freeze-thaw** cycle can damage less durable materials. Choosing drains constructed from high-density polyethylene (HDPE) or epoxy-coated metal can provide the necessary resilience. It’s also essential to consider the placement of the drains; ensuring they are positioned to handle melting snow and ice runoff is vital.
Hot and Arid Climates
In hotter climates, UV exposure can degrade certain materials over time. Floor drains in these areas should be made from UV-resistant materials. Additionally, the design should prevent water evaporation, which can result in unpleasant odors and encourage pest infestations.
Choosing the Right Materials for Your Floor Drains
Selecting the right material for your floor drain is integral to its performance and longevity. Here, we delve into the most common materials used for floor drains and their suitability for various climates.
Stainless Steel
Stainless steel is renowned for its **durability** and resistance to **corrosion**. It is an excellent choice for humid environments where moisture can lead to rust. Additionally, its aesthetic appeal makes it suitable for modern bathrooms.
Cast Iron
Cast iron is robust and highly durable, making it ideal for heavy traffic areas. However, it may not be the best choice for places with extreme moisture unless treated with protective coatings.
PVC and ABS Plastic
These plastic materials are lightweight, corrosion-resistant, and budget-friendly. They are excellent options for residential applications but may not be suitable for high-load commercial settings.
HDPE (High-Density Polyethylene)
HDPE is lightweight yet sturdy, making it resistant to impact and chemical damage. Its resilience makes it a perfect option for cold climates where freezing can occur.
Different Drain Designs Suitable for Varying Climates
The design of your floor drain can affect its functionality. Here we explore various designs that cater to different climates.
Linear Drains
Linear drains are long and streamlined, ideal for contemporary aesthetics. They are particularly beneficial in wet climates, allowing for efficient water flow and drainage.
Square and Round Drains
These traditional designs are versatile and can effectively handle moderate water flow. They are suitable for most climate types but require regular maintenance to prevent clogging.
Trench Drains
For areas prone to flooding, trench drains provide a substantial drainage solution. Their design accommodates high volumes of water, making them perfect for heavy rainfall regions.
Maintenance Considerations Based on Climate
Maintaining your floor drain is essential regardless of climate conditions. However, different climates may necessitate specific maintenance strategies.
Wet and Humid Climates
Regular inspections for clogs and debris are necessary. Additionally, using a biocide or antimicrobial treatment can help maintain hygiene and prevent mold growth.
Cold Climates
In these regions, ensuring that drains are free from ice accumulation is crucial. Regularly clearing snow and treating the area with de-icing products can prevent damage to the drain system.
Hot Climates
In hotter regions, regular cleaning is necessary to remove dust and debris. Checking for signs of UV damage or brittleness in materials should also be part of your maintenance routine.
Key Installation Tips for Optimal Performance
Proper installation of floor drains can significantly impact their effectiveness. Here are key tips to ensure success.
Ensure Proper Slope
Always install floor drains at a slight angle to facilitate water flow towards the drain. A slope of 1-2% is typically recommended to ensure efficient drainage.
Use Quality Seals and Gaskets
Utilizing high-quality seals and gaskets can prevent leaks. This is particularly important in climates with heavy rainfall or snow, where excess water can compromise foundation integrity.
Follow Local Plumbing Codes
Ensure compliance with local plumbing codes and regulations. This can prevent issues in the future and ensure that your installation meets safety standards.

Expert Recommendations for Specific Climate Conditions
Based on professional insight, here are some tailored recommendations for various climates:
For Wet Climates
Choose stainless steel linear drains with larger grates to manage high water flow and debris.
For Cold Climates
Opt for HDPE drains with insulation. Ensure placement to facilitate melting snow and ice runoff.
For Hot Climates
Select UV-resistant materials like PVC and ensure regular cleaning to prevent buildup and odors.
Frequently Asked Questions
1. What type of floor drain is best for a residential bathroom?
A: Stainless steel or PVC drains are excellent options, as they offer durability and resistance to corrosion.
2. How do I ensure my floor drain does not clog?
A: Regular maintenance, including cleaning the drain grates and checking for debris, can help prevent clogs.
3. Can I install a floor drain myself?
A: While it's possible, it's recommended to consult with a professional, especially to ensure compliance with local plumbing codes.
4. What should I do if my floor drain backs up?
A: Check for clogs in the drain or pipes. If problems persist, consult a plumber for a thorough inspection.
5. Do all floor drains require traps?
A: Yes, traps are essential for preventing sewer gases from entering your home and help maintain proper drainage.
